Sébastien Barot

 

I am engineer in forestry (FIF-ENGREG, Nancy, France). I have achieved a PhD thesis in 1999 about the demography of a palm tree species in the field station of Lamto in Ivory Coast. I have then made a post-doc at IIAS (International Institute for Applied Systems Analysis, Austria) on the evolutionary impact of commercial fisheries. I am working for the French Institute for Researches for the Development (IRD) since 2002 on different subjects of soil ecology, mostly on aboveground-belowground interactions and nutrient cycling. In particular I have studied the effect of earthworms on plant growth and demography. Since 2011 I am working for Bioemco laboratory in Paris. In all my researches I have combined field work, experimentations in controlled conditions and mathematical modelling. Finally, in terms of application of ecological knowledge, I am strongly interested in Ecological Engineering and agro-ecology.
